[ _tux_rulez @ 01.03.2004. 10:40 ] @
Imam sljedeci slucaj. U sobi imam
dva kompa, povezani su preko huba sa dvije mrezne sa adresama 10.0.40.1/2
Prvi kompjuter, ima i wireless karticu, preko koje idem na iternet. Wireless
kartica prvo se konketuje na wireless mrezu gdje dobija, localnu IP adresu
192.168.0.225. Zelim da mogu preko drugog kompa ici na internet preko wirelessa, i naravno tom drugom kompjuteru dodijeliti ip
adresu tipa 192.168.0.226 tako da ljudi iz wireless mreze mogu pristupati i
drugom kompu. U fazi sam citanja Adv-Routing-HOWTO, ali koliko mi slobodno vrijeme dozvoljava. Ako neko vec ima volje da mi to objasni, neka uradi jednu toretsku analizu, npr. sta koja komanda radi i slicno. Hvala Unaprijed.
[ filmil @ 01.03.2004. 11:06 ] @
Stvar je jako jednostavna, nije potrebno suviše izučavati adv-routing.
Stvar se svodi na to da računaru koji ima wireless karticu naložiš da
radi ip forwarding i ip masquerading u ime drugih računara sa lokalne
mreže. Štaviše imam isti setup kod kuće tako da ti verovatno mogu
pomoći, ali tek pošto se vratim kući i vidim šta gde stoji. :)

f
[ _tux_rulez @ 01.03.2004. 15:02 ] @
Baš me obradovao tvoj prijatni odgovor. Mislim da je forum baš stvorwen iz tih razloga, i ako ima dobrih ljudi da pomognu, to treba da se i desi. Stvarno ne želim da budem uključen u neku vrstu flameova i slicno. Inače prije nego što postam neko pitanje, potrudim se da prečešljam forum, ali nisam naišao na konkretan odgovor ni rješenje, a pogotovo objašnjenje. Također, mislim da je svaki slučaj na neki način poseban....nego,

želim ako već ovo riješimo da konfiguracija ostane i aktuelna poslije, samog restarta sistema, iako ga radim samo u nuždi.

Na računaru gdje mi je wireless već sam uradio:

Code:
echo 1 > /proc/sys/net/ipv4/ip_forward


i mislim da je to uključilo Ip forwarding, ali kako mogu vidjeti kako to radi?

i trebam li sta raditi na drugoj mašini?

[ Bager @ 01.03.2004. 15:26 ] @
Uvijek je problem traziti nesto, ako ne znas tacno kako se zove, zar ne?
Trazi na forumu "Linux - Mreze" kljucnu rijec iptables ili evo ti tema. Naravno, skontaces da umjesto ppp0 treba da stavis mreznu koja ide na net.
[ filmil @ 01.03.2004. 15:56 ] @
Teško da bih mogao da objasnim bolje nego što je mohican već učinio...

f
[ _tux_rulez @ 01.03.2004. 17:12 ] @
Bager, u pravu si, prvobitno sam tražio "Linux routing" Sacu da pogledam, ovu drugu temu....pa se javljam, sa razultatima...p.s. prijatelj mi je valjda ovo na windowsu uradio preko bridginga, pa sam jedno vrijeme pokusavao i bridge hehe
[ _tux_rulez @ 01.03.2004. 17:44 ] @
uradio sam sljedeće, kako mohican pise, samo bez onoga sa dinamickom ip adresom:

echo "1" > /proc/sys/net/ipv4/ip_forward
iptables -t nat -P POSTROUTING DROP
i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E

al neradi...sta trebam staviti na kompjuter, koji ce ici preko ovoga sto ima internet.
[ Bager @ 02.03.2004. 11:15 ] @
echo "1" > /proc/sys/net/ipv4/ip_forward
i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E

Ovo treba da uradis na kompjuteru koji je povezan na internet preko eth0 mrezne, a na kompjuteru koji nije direktno povezan nego ide preko ovoga treba da unese DNS server od tvog provajdera i to bi trebalo da radi.
[ _tux_rulez @ 02.03.2004. 13:09 ] @
Probao sam, ne radi, moram napomenuti da moj kompjuter ide na internet preko wlan0, odnosno preko wireless kartice, a eth0 je tu da bi ih povezao.
[ Bager @ 02.03.2004. 13:19 ] @
Pa to znaci da trebas da stavis wlan0 umjesto onoga zatamnjenog.
[ _tux_rulez @ 02.03.2004. 15:23 ] @
Provao sam davno sa wlan0, ne radi......
[ Bager @ 02.03.2004. 16:46 ] @
Onda jedino preostaje da ti u kernelu nema podrske za ip forward i ostalo potrebno ili nisi podesio DNS kako treba. Ima li kakvih poruka o greskama kad pokrenes iptables? Probaj da pingujes 216.239.59.99 (google.com) pa vidi radi li.
[ _tux_rulez @ 02.03.2004. 18:44 ] @
trebam da ukljucim ip_forwarding sa: echo "1" > /proc/sys/net/ipv4/ip_forward        - medjutim te datoteke nije bilo, sto mi je bilo cudno......
pa sam otisao u /usr/src/linux/net/ipv4 i tamo opet nema ip_forward
kako dalje?
[ Bager @ 03.03.2004. 12:33 ] @
Onda ocigledno nemas podrsku za ip_forward u kernelu pa ces morarati da ga kompajliras sa istom
[ _tux_rulez @ 04.03.2004. 13:25 ] @
# cat /etc/rc.config
IP_FORWARD="no"


sacu promijeniti na yes, pa cu vidjeti hocel sta proraditi

takodjer u datoteci: /etc/sysconfig/sysctl

## Path: Network/General
## Description: forward/route IP(v4) packets
## Type: yesno
## Default: no
#
# Runtime-configurable parameter: forward IP packets.
# Is this host a router? (yes/no)
#
IP_FORWARD="no"

## Path: Network/General
## Description: forward/route IPv6 packets
## Type: yesno
## Default: no
#
# Runtime-configurable parameter: forward IPv6 packets.
#
IPV6_FORWARD="no"

[ _tux_rulez @ 25.03.2004. 22:24 ] @
USPIO SAM! ukljucite u YASTU IP FOW, ako ste SuSE korisnik i ukucajte iptables komandu i radi..

Hvala svima

[ _tux_rulez @ 26.03.2004. 20:19 ] @
Medjutim, ako ugasim taj kompjuter gdje mi je net access, onda se iptables pravila gube. Odnosno, moram svaki put, ukucavati komandu....sto nije problem, jer mogu dodati u rc,boot.local datoteku, tako da se postavke svaki put prilikom boota primjene...ali me zanima kako da trajno ucinim ove promjene.

Pozdravi